Vitaliy Filippov
|
1c2df841c2
|
Fix failed assert(!scrub_list_op) on OSD restart with pending scrubs
Test / test_change_pg_count (push) Successful in 38s
Details
Test / test_change_pg_count_ec (push) Successful in 38s
Details
Test / test_change_pg_size (push) Successful in 9s
Details
Test / test_create_nomaxid (push) Successful in 8s
Details
Test / test_etcd_fail (push) Successful in 53s
Details
Test / test_failure_domain (push) Successful in 15s
Details
Test / test_interrupted_rebalance (push) Successful in 2m3s
Details
Test / test_interrupted_rebalance_imm (push) Successful in 2m55s
Details
Test / test_interrupted_rebalance_ec (push) Successful in 2m43s
Details
Test / test_interrupted_rebalance_ec_imm (push) Successful in 1m31s
Details
Test / test_minsize_1 (push) Successful in 14s
Details
Test / test_move_reappear (push) Successful in 17s
Details
Test / test_rebalance_verify (push) Successful in 3m9s
Details
Test / test_rebalance_verify_imm (push) Successful in 3m10s
Details
Test / test_rebalance_verify_ec (push) Successful in 3m15s
Details
Test / test_rebalance_verify_ec_imm (push) Successful in 4m45s
Details
Test / test_rm (push) Successful in 18s
Details
Test / test_snapshot (push) Successful in 35s
Details
Test / test_snapshot_ec (push) Successful in 18s
Details
Test / test_splitbrain (push) Successful in 15s
Details
Test / test_write (push) Successful in 35s
Details
Test / test_write_xor (push) Successful in 1m12s
Details
Test / test_write_no_same (push) Successful in 15s
Details
Test / test_heal_pg_size_2 (push) Successful in 3m41s
Details
Test / test_scrub (push) Successful in 33s
Details
Test / test_scrub_zero_osd_2 (push) Successful in 29s
Details
Test / test_scrub_xor (push) Successful in 30s
Details
Test / test_scrub_pg_size_3 (push) Successful in 51s
Details
Test / test_scrub_pg_size_6_pg_minsize_4_osd_count_6_ec (push) Successful in 31s
Details
Test / test_scrub_ec (push) Successful in 26s
Details
|
2023-06-17 17:02:54 +03:00 |
Vitaliy Filippov
|
ce02f47de6
|
Allow to disable scrub_find_best
|
2023-05-21 12:33:38 +03:00 |
Vitaliy Filippov
|
fa90b5a4e7
|
Schedule automatic scrubs correctly (not just after previous scrub)
|
2023-05-20 23:20:09 +03:00 |
Vitaliy Filippov
|
6ca20aa194
|
Allow scrub to fix corrupted object states
|
2023-05-20 23:19:39 +03:00 |
Vitaliy Filippov
|
6648f6bb6e
|
Implement ambiguity detection during scrub
|
2023-05-20 23:19:39 +03:00 |
Vitaliy Filippov
|
0c78dd7178
|
Add no_scrub flag
|
2023-05-20 23:19:39 +03:00 |
Vitaliy Filippov
|
3c924397e7
|
Store next scrub timestamp instead of last scrub timestamp
|
2023-05-20 23:19:39 +03:00 |
Vitaliy Filippov
|
c3bd26193d
|
Implement PG scrub runner
|
2023-05-20 23:19:39 +03:00 |
Vitaliy Filippov
|
43b77d7619
|
Implement scrubbing "data path" - OSD_OP_SCRUB
|
2023-05-20 23:19:39 +03:00 |